    • The Game-Changing Tax Move That Short-Term Rental Owners Overlook | Erik Oliver
      Feb 24 2026

      💡 What if there’s a way to slash your tax bill while building real estate wealth—without buying a single new property?

      In this episode, we turn the spotlight on one of the most powerful, yet often overlooked, wealth-building tools for investors: tax strategy. Eric Oliver of Maven Cost Segregation to break down, in plain English, how cost segregation and 100% bonus depreciation can dramatically reduce your taxes—especially if you own or plan to own short-term rentals.

      Eric explains how accelerated depreciation really works, what the so-called “short-term rental loophole” is (and isn’t), and why material participation and intent are key in the eyes of the IRS. Jason and Rory go even further, sharing real numbers from their own portfolio, including how they used a look-back study and a “poor man’s reverse 1031” strategy to offset a large tax bill after selling a property.

      If you’ve ever thought taxes were just an unavoidable cost of investing, this episode will make you see them as a strategic wealth-building tool.

      Things we discussed in this episode:

      1. Cost segregation basics – accelerating depreciation by breaking a property into components with shorter lives.
      2. Bonus depreciation – how 100% bonus magnifies cost seg savings in year one.
      3. STRs vs. LTRs – why short‑term rentals can offset W2 income but long‑term rentals usually can’t.
      4. “Short‑term rental loophole” – a legal, code-based strategy, not a shady trick.
      5. Material participation – key IRS tests, especially 100 hours and more time than anyone else.
      6. Timing a purchase – buying late in the year to more easily document material participation.
      7. Jason & Rory’s $900k deal – large depreciation created, especially from exterior work and landscaping.
      8. “Poor man’s reverse 1031” – using cost seg to help offset capital gains from a property sale.
      9. Look‑back studies & Form 3115 – reclaiming missed depreciation from prior years.
      10. Tax planning strategy – using cost seg selectively to manage tax brackets and avoid wasting deductions.

    • Why I Stopped Letting Airbnb Control My Business | Eric Goldreyer
      Feb 17 2026

      💡 Tired of losing revenue to Airbnb and Vrbo? What if you could connect directly with guests and keep more of your profits?

      Today, we sit down with Eric Goldreyer, CEO and founder of Savvy, to explore the future of direct bookings in vacation rentals. Eric shares how Savvy’s book-direct marketplace empowers property managers to connect travelers straight to professionally managed properties—often saving guests 15–20% compared to traditional OTAs.

      We dive into why owning the guest relationship is crucial, how technology should enhance rather than replace hospitality, and what property managers need—like solid websites, PMS integrations, and trust-building tools—to grow their direct booking share.

      If you’re serious about boosting profitability and reducing dependence on OTAs, this episode gives a practical, insider look at where the industry is headed and how to get ahead of the curve.

      🎧 Tune in and discover actionable strategies to take control of your bookings and maximize your rental income!

      Things we discussed in this episode:


      1. What Savvy Is – Book-direct vacation rental marketplace.
      2. Guest Savings – Guests save ~15–20% per stay.
      3. Direct Connection – Guests contact managers directly.
      4. Own the Relationship – Managers keep guest data and terms.
      5. OTA Limitations – Hard to reward repeat guests on Airbnb.
      6. How Savvy Makes Money – Free listings, paid boosted exposure.
      7. Platform Scale – Thousands of managers, 150k+ properties.
      8. Direct Booking Trend – More share shifting away from OTAs.
      9. Direct-Ready Setup – Need good site, photos, PMS, booking engine.
      10. Pros Only Inventory – Only professionally managed properties listed.

    • I NEVER Thought I’d Quit Teaching to Manage Airbnbs (But I Did) | Colleen Coale
      Feb 10 2026

      What happens when a lifelong teacher realizes the classroom isn’t the only place she can make an impact?

      Today we sit down with Colleen Coale, co-founder of Hurford Place Hospitality, to unpack her journey from elementary school teacher to running 90% of a fast-growing short-term rental management company in Pennsylvania’s Pocono Mountains. Colleen shares the mindset shift that moved her from “I’m just a teacher” to confident business owner, how joining a mastermind changed everything, and why it took nine months of persistence to land her very first client.

      We dig into how community and education fueled her growth from one property to ten, what it’s really like building a values-driven business alongside her husband, and the deeply personal motivation behind her mission to create inclusive, ADA-friendly vacation homes. This is a candid conversation about identity, grit, and redefining success—on your own terms.


      Things we discussed in this episode:


          1. Colleen’s shift from elementary school teacher to STR business owner.
          2. Jason’s own “chapter two” from media to short‑term rentals.
          3. What Hereford Place Hospitality does in the Poconos market.
          4. Colleen’s early doubts about masterminds and STR education costs.
          5. How the mastermind community provided support and first leads.
          6. The long ramp-up: nine months to their first management client.
          7. Their “ideal” owners: nervous, first‑time buyers who need guidance.
          8. Cleaners and local teams as major referral sources.
          9. The realities of building a business with a spouse.
          10. Colleen’s mission to create ADA‑friendly, accessible vacation homes.
